Heathrow, Gatwick or a deferral? The Davis Commission report is due on Wednesday

30/06/2015 by Kevincm

On Wednesday, the UK Government will have a tough decision to make – as well as annoy of lot of local people at the same time.

The Davis Commission will be delivering the report on Airport Expansion in the South East of England at 07:00BST tomorrow.

There are three options on the table that the Davis Commission is considering:

  1. Extending one of the two runways at Heathrow Airport
  2. The building of a 3rd runway at Heathrow Airport
  3. The building of a 2nd runway at Gatwick Airport

Of course, this report is a recommendation to UK Government, which itself is have issues with the expansion of Heathrow and Gatwick, with ministers inside the cabinet arguing about the expansion.

It should also be noted that these parliamentary constituencies that could be affected by the noise are themselves Conservative held seats – the party currently in power in the UK.

Sadly, The UK government tends to think on a 5 yearly basis – when the elected representatives are put on the line for re-election, and seemingly cannot think about the long term needs that infrastructure requires.

None the less, expansion is needed at London airports – however, how this will be derived is a different matter completely.

What the Davis Commission will release tomorrow will be anticipated… and will be debated heavily.
